Fix an issue where the Ambience layer would break looping points for all other channels due to loop_start and loop_end only being a single variable. (#164)

This occurs due to BASS not having any private variables of its own, so it was simply using the public variables loop_start and loop_end as reference - since those changed for any new song playing on another channel, the old looping points got replaced, and the seamless looping stops working.
The solution was easy - just make a  loop_start/loop_end variable for every supported channel - so 4 variables in our case.
